The Geberit Awards 2016 aims to recognise exemplary performance in installation throughout the heating, bathroom and plumbing industries.
The third annual Geberit Awards are looking for the ‘Best Installer Team’, ‘Best Supply Systems Installer’, ‘Best Domestic Bathroom Installer’ and ‘Best Apprentice’.
The judging panel, which will be made up from construction experts and industry professionals, is eager to hear from apprentices themselves. In each category, an overall winner will be decided, along with two runners up.
Prizes include £1,000 for the winners, and Makita Drill Sets and Radios for the runners up.
Entries are now open: the judges are looking for 150 words per nomination, which can be supported by an image. Entrants should aim to showcase their most innovative Geberit product installations: successful nominations should show how installers have overcome difficult challenges to ensure a quality end result.
Installers have two months to make their nominations, with the final deadline scheduled for 30th November.
